Fabric Substrate and Manufacturing Method Thereof
20200149217 · 2020-05-14 ·

According to the present invention, there is provided a fabric substrate for mounting a light emitting element. The fabric substrate includes a fabric layer including at least one fabric, a stress buffer layer that is disposed on the fabric layer and minimizes an occurrence of physical strain and stress caused by bending the fabric layer, and a flattening layer that is disposed on the stress buffer layer and provides a flat surface to allow a light emitting element to operate.

Wall Covering
20200095777 · 2020-03-26 ·

A wall covering in the form of a bordure or a tile sticker that can be stuck onto a wall or tile surface. The wall covering is comprised of at least one supporting body with a visible front side and a back side. At least a portion of the visible front side comprises a printed lenticular foil and/or a lenticular foil with images stuck behind it.

Mobile App Controlled Emoji Display Pendant
20240028073 · 2024-01-25 ·

The present invention is comprised of a pendant with a wearable display (functional jewelry) and accompanying mobile app that allow users to choose an emoji/image from the app for display on the pendant. The invention will transmit image data (jpegs, gifs) from its mobile app for wireless pickup by the Emogems pendant (AMOLED 1.4 round display). One image/emoji will be displayed on the pendant at a time, although the user will be able to replace displayed images at will by making selections from the emoji library on the app. When no emoji is selected, while the display is on, the Emogems logo is visible on the display as a default image. Most images/emoji will be static, but some include animated gifs that animate indefinitely.

SHOE CAPABLE OF CHANGING IMAGES
20200077056 · 2020-03-05 ·

Shoe capable of projecting images that can be changed, wherein the shoe can not only change images projected in front thereof, so as to attract a wearer's interest, but can also naturally induce his or her walking. The subject matter of the present invention is a shoe capable of projecting images that can be changed, the shoe including a shoe body and an image projector detachably attached to the shoe body so as to project an image onto the ground, wherein the image projector comprises: a light source for emitting light; an image cell installed in front of the light source so as to form an image to be projected; and an image changing means for transmitting a control signal to the image cell so as to change the image to be projected.

Digital Passive Advertising System and Method
20190362391 · 2019-11-28 ·

A digital passive advertising display system and method where affiliates register to be walking billboards. Each affiliate can carry a display tag on their belongings such as on backpacks, or they can carry a larger display on their body. The tag or display is in radio contact with the affiliate's smartphone using a short range radio system such a BLUETOOTH or WiFi. A central system accepts location-based or global brand ads from advertisers and keeps track of the location of affiliates. Location-based ads based on an affiliate's location can then be pushed to his or her smartphone and hence to the display or tag. The thus affiliate displays the ad for passers-by to see. Affiliates can be compensated for carrying displays and displaying ads, and affiliates can sign up sub-affiliates.

Concealable Identification Sleeve
20190333416 · 2019-10-31 ·

The concealable identification sleeve (hereafter, the sleeve) is configured to be worn on an arm of a user. The sleeve is capable of transitioning from compact and concealed to expanded and highly visible. The sleeve includes a first end having a first ring and a second end having a second ring. The first and second rings each define an opening and include complementary connection mechanisms. A body portion is disposed between the first ring and the second ring. The body transitions from a concealed state to an expanded state between the first and second rings. In the concealed state, the first and second rings are positioned at a first length L.sub.1 from each other and in the expanded state the first and second rings are positioned at a length L.sub.2 from each other that is greater than the first length L.sub.1.

HAT WITH INTERCHANGEABLE AND FULLY ADJUSTABLE CLOSURE BANDS
20190289948 · 2019-09-26 ·

A hat having a closure band which is removably attached to the hat is disclosed. The hat may have a sweatband that is sewn in place to the perimeter portion of the hat along the bottom of the perimeter portion as well as at a distance above the bottom portion to create a loop aperture. The sweatband and the closure band may have adjustable fastening devices such as a hook and loop material (e.g., Velcro). The closure band may be removably attached to the hat by adjusting the length to accommodate the circumference of a wearer's head, and may be removable attached onto the hook and loop material on the sweatband. Hence, a wearer may remove and replace the closure band with another closure band having a different color, logo, or material to show support for another sports team.

Wearable Interactive Display System
20190265750 · 2019-08-29 ·

A wearable interactive display system is an apparatus that allows a user to present and communicate information to individuals around the user wearing the apparatus. The apparatus includes a backpack, at least one camera, at least one light source, at last one main smart device, a processor, and a power source. The backpack houses and upholds the at least one camera, the at least one light source, the at least one main smart device, the processor, and the power source. The backpack further includes a main compartment and a tablet compartment. The main compartment houses items and the processor. The tablet compartment houses the at least one main smart device. The tablet compartment includes a flap and a transparent layer. The flap allows the at least one smart device to be easily accessed. The transparent layer allows a display screen to be visible while housed within the tablet compartment.

Portable Apparatus with Deployable Visibility Enhancing Signals
20190239624 · 2019-08-08 ·

A portable apparatus with deployable visibility enhancing signals includes a backpack member from which a pair of flag members are deployable to extend up and out of the backpack member behind a wearer's shoulders to resemble wings of a beast or an animal. The flag members incorporate bright, visually distinct fabrics, to increase the visibility profile of the wearer. An elongate member, reminiscent of a tail, may also be incorporated and deployed to dangle behind the wearer to augment the semblance of a winged beast or animal.
